My Buying Guides on Hair Products For Afro Hair
Understanding My Afro Hair Needs
When I shop for hair products for Afro hair, I first think about my hair’s unique needs. Afro hair is often naturally dry, delicate, and prone to breakage, so I look for products that add moisture, protect my strands, and help with manageability. I’ve learned that what works for straight or wavy hair usually does not give my hair the same results.
What I Look for in a Moisturizing Shampoo
For me, a good shampoo should cleanse my scalp without stripping away natural oils. I prefer sulfate-free shampoos because they feel gentler on my hair. I also look for ingredients like aloe vera, glycerin, shea butter, and coconut oil since they help keep my hair soft and hydrated after washing.
Why My Conditioner Choice Matters
Conditioner is one of the most important products in my routine. I always choose a rich, creamy conditioner that helps me detangle my hair easily. When my hair feels extra dry, I go for a deep conditioner or hair mask. I’ve found that regular conditioning makes my hair easier to manage and helps reduce breakage.
My Favorite Leave-In Products
Leave-in conditioners are a must for my Afro hair. They help me keep moisture in my hair throughout the day and make styling easier. I usually look for lightweight but nourishing formulas that won’t leave my hair feeling greasy or heavy. A good leave-in also helps me protect my hair before using other styling products.
How I Choose Oils and Butters
I use oils and butters to seal in moisture after washing and conditioning my hair. My favorites include jojoba oil, argan oil, castor oil, and shea butter. I use them carefully because too much can weigh my hair down. I’ve found that the right oil helps my hair stay soft, shiny, and less prone to dryness.
What I Consider in Styling Products
When I buy styling products, I think about the look I want and how much hold I need. For twist-outs, braid-outs, or defined curls, I choose creams, gels, or curl enhancers that give definition without flaking. I always check that the product supports moisture and doesn’t make my hair crunchy or stiff.
My Tips for Scalp Care
Healthy hair starts with a healthy scalp, so I pay attention to scalp-friendly products too. I like gentle scalp cleansers, soothing oils, and products that reduce itchiness or buildup. If my scalp feels irritated, I avoid harsh ingredients and focus on calming, nourishing formulas.
Ingredients I Try to Avoid
I try to avoid products with harsh sulfates, drying alcohols, and too many artificial ingredients that can make my hair feel brittle. I also watch out for products that contain heavy buildup-causing ingredients if I know I’ll be using them often. Reading the label helps me make better choices for my hair.
